#include "wombats.h"
#include<bits/stdc++.h>
using namespace std;
const int maxr = 5010, maxc = 210;
const int maxblock = sqrt(maxr) + 10;
void precalculate();
int h[maxr][maxc], v[maxr][maxc], dp[maxblock][maxc][maxc];
int r, c, block_size;
void init(int R, int C, int H[5000][200], int V[5000][200]) {
/* ... */
block_size = sqrt(R) + 1;
r = R;
c = C;
for (int i = 0; i < R - 1; i ++)
for (int j = 0; j < C; j ++)
v[i][j] = V[i][j];
for (int i = 0; i < R; i ++)
for (int j = 0; j < C - 1; j ++)
h[i][j] = H[i][j];
precalculate();
}
const int inf = 2e9 + 10;
int fp[2][maxc];
void fix_row(int i)
{
for (int j = 1; j < c; j ++)
{
fp[i & 1][j] = min(fp[i & 1][j], fp[i & 1][j - 1] + h[i][j - 1]);
}
for (int j = c - 2; j >= 0; j --)
{
fp[i & 1][j] = min(fp[i & 1][j], fp[i & 1][j + 1] + h[i][j]);
}
}
void calc_block(int bl)
{
int st = bl * block_size;
int en = (bl + 1) * block_size - 1;
en = min(en, r - 1);
for (int d = 0; d < c; d ++)
{
for (int j = 0; j < c; j ++)
{
fp[0][j] = fp[1][j] = inf;
}
fp[st & 1][d] = 0;
fix_row(st);
for (int i = st + 1; i <= en; i ++)
{
for (int j = 0; j < c; j ++)
{
fp[i & 1][j] = fp[(i - 1) & 1][j] + v[i - 1][j];
}
fix_row(i);
}
for (int j = 0; j < c; j ++)
{
dp[bl][d][j] = fp[en & 1][j];
}
}
}
void precalculate()
{
for (int bl = 0; bl <= (r - 1) / block_size; bl ++)
{
/// cout << "calc block " << endl;
calc_block(bl);
}
///exit(0);
}
void changeH(int P, int Q, int W) {
/* ... */
h[P][Q] = W;
calc_block(P / block_size);
}
void changeV(int P, int Q, int W) {
/* ... */
v[P][Q] = W;
calc_block(P / block_size);
}
int arr[maxc], temp[maxc];
int escape(int V1, int V2)
{
int v1 = V1, v2 = V2;
for (int j = 0; j < c; j ++)
arr[j] = dp[0][v1][j];
for (int bl = 1; bl <= (r - 1) / block_size; bl ++)
{
int t = bl * block_size;
for (int j = 0; j < c; j ++)
{
arr[j] = arr[j] + v[t - 1][j];
}
for (int j = 1; j < c; j ++)
{
arr[j] = min(arr[j], arr[j - 1] + h[t][j - 1]);
}
for (int j = c - 2; j >= 0; j --)
{
arr[j] = min(arr[j], arr[j + 1] + h[t][j]);
}
for (int j = 0; j < c; j ++)
temp[j] = inf;
for (int j = 0; j < c; j ++)
{
for (int d = 0; d < c; d ++)
temp[j] =min(temp[j], arr[d] + dp[bl][d][j]);
}
for (int j = 0; j < c; j ++)
arr[j] = temp[j];
}
return arr[v2];
}
